There's about nothing in the Spider-man video that can't or hasn't be done with the hardware available. It's just a matter of being clever on how they go about it.

You can clearly see aggressive LoD-ing hidden by a bunch of effects, the fast movement scenes are accompanied by a widening of the FoV (progressive along the longitudinal direction, what hides geometry warping) that makes the speed seem much faster than it actually is (and, as a result, reduces geometry loading), lighting is probably baked in and interpolated between states (just like Horizon does, in fact), etc.

Insomniac is more than technically capable enough to do it.
